144件ヒット
[1-100件を表示]
(0.157秒)
ライブラリ
- ビルトイン (138)
-
bigdecimal
/ util (6)
検索結果
先頭5件
-
NilClass
# rationalize -> Rational (12401.0) -
0/1 を返します。
...0/1 を返します。
@param eps 許容する誤差
引数 eps は常に無視されます。
//emlist[例][ruby]{
nil.rationalize # => (0/1)
nil.rationalize(100) # => (0/1)
nil.rationalize(0.1) # => (0/1)
//}... -
NilClass
# rationalize(eps) -> Rational (12401.0) -
0/1 を返します。
...0/1 を返します。
@param eps 許容する誤差
引数 eps は常に無視されます。
//emlist[例][ruby]{
nil.rationalize # => (0/1)
nil.rationalize(100) # => (0/1)
nil.rationalize(0.1) # => (0/1)
//}... -
NilClass
# to _ i -> Integer (12208.0) -
0 を返します。
...0 を返します。
//emlist[例][ruby]{
nil.to_i #=> 0
//}... -
NilClass
# to _ d -> BigDecimal (9201.0) -
BigDecimal オブジェクトの 0.0 を返します。
...BigDecimal オブジェクトの 0.0 を返します。
Ruby 2.6 で追加されたメソッドです。
//emlist[][ruby]{
require "bigdecimal"
require "bigdecimal/util"
p nil.to_d # => 0.0
//}... -
NilClass
# to _ r -> Rational (9201.0) -
0/1 を返します。
...0/1 を返します。
//emlist[例][ruby]{
nil.to_r # => (0/1)
//}... -
NilClass
# to _ s -> String (9201.0) -
空文字列 "" を返します。
...空文字列 "" を返します。
//emlist[例][ruby]{
nil.to_s # => ""
//}... -
NilClass
# to _ c -> Complex (9123.0) -
0+0i を返します。
...0+0i を返します。
//emlist[例][ruby]{
nil.to_c # => (0+0i)
//}... -
NilClass
# to _ a -> Array (9101.0) -
空配列 [] を返します。
...空配列 [] を返します。
//emlist[例][ruby]{
nil.to_a #=> []
//}... -
NilClass
# to _ f -> Float (9101.0) -
0.0 を返します。
...0.0 を返します。
//emlist[例][ruby]{
nil.to_f #=> 0.0
//}... -
NilClass
# to _ h -> {} (9101.0) -
{} を返します。
...{} を返します。
//emlist[例][ruby]{
nil.to_h #=> {}
//}...